WebVehicular Ad Hoc Networks (VANETs) is technology that integrates the capabilities of new generation wireless networks to vehicles. VANET builds a robust Ad-Hoc network between mobile vehicles and roadside units. It is a form of MANET that establishes communication among nearby vehicles and adjacent fixed apparatus, usually described … Webmeeting the strict time delay requirements of vehicle networking. Introduction. Vehicular Ad hoc NETworks (VANETs) belong to a subcategory of traditional Mobile Ad hoc NETworks (MANETs). The main feature of VANETs is that mobile nodes are vehicles endowed with sophisticated “on-board” equipments, traveling on constrained paths (i.e., roads and lanes), and communicating … markey who played tarzan\u0027s janeWebApr 24, 2024 · Index Terms VANET Vehicle adhoc network, AODV adhoc on demand distance vector routing, VANET vehicular adhoc network, OBU on board unit, RSU road side unit.
